Ingredients for Spicy Soybean Cookies
- Light Brown Sugar
- Splenda Granular
- Soy Oil
- ½ cup prune baby food
- Egg Whites
- Unsweetened Applesauce
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up soybeans (roasted and roughly chopped)
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 teaspoons baking powder
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- ½ teaspoon ground nutmeg
- Clove
- ¼ teaspoon ground ginger
- Old Fashioned Oatmeal

How to Make Spicy Soybean Cookies
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Line baking sheets with parchment paper.
- In a large mixing bowl, combine 1 cup packed brown sugar, ½ cup vegetable oil, ½ cup prune baby food, 1 large egg, ½ cup applesauce, and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ract.
- Beat well with an electric mixer until light and fluffy. Add 1 cup soybeans and beat until just combined.
- In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together 2 cups all-purpose flour, 2 teaspoons baking powder, 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on, ½ teaspoon ground nutmeg, ¼ teaspoon ground cloves, and ¼ teaspoon ground ginger.
-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ix.
- Stir in 1 cup rolled oats.
-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ving about 2 inches between each cookie.
-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own and the centers are set. Avoid overbaking.
- Let the cookies c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
